Power Quality assessment and mitigation at Walya-Steel Industries and Ethio-Plastic share company

Abstract

In this paper, electric power quality (PQ) in Walya- Steel Industries PLC (WSIPLC) and Ethio-Plastic Share Company (EPSC), which are customers of Ethiopian Electric Power Corporation (EEPCo), are studied. PQ indicators of the two industries are recorded and analyzed. The study demonstrated that harmonic distortion is high relative to the corresponding IEEE recommended maximum permissible values while power factor of the two factories’ power systems are low. Other PQ  indicators are within the range of allowable values. The simulation done on the modeled power system of the two factories demonstrates that major source of harmonic distortion is power electronic converters, which are in use in both factories. Based on the simulation results, capacitive filter for the harmonic distortion and low power factor mitigation have been designed.
